TURN-208: Gatevale turnstile counters at the Merrow Field pilot double-count when a rotation reverses mid-cycle. Attendance totals drift roughly 2% high per event. The debounce window fix is implemented, reviewed by Ilsa, and soak-tested across two simulated match days without drift. Ready for your cut; the candidate build is identified below.

trace token, tagag-tafog: htk6_5ed18c

// Heads up, contractor folks: this constant controls how far ahead the
// Mendota Clinic reminder job looks when queuing appointment pings.
// Don't crank it past 72 hours — patients complained when reminders
// landed three days early, and the scheduler double-fires if the window
// overlaps the nightly rebuild. If you change it, run the dry-run mode
// first and sanity-check the queue size. Any tweak here needs sign-off
// from the reminders lead. For audit purposes, tag your change with the
// build token below.

session token of tajef-bageg = htk21_5d90d574934f3ccae6437

Ticket: Config drift in Proselint-Q staging

Welcome aboard — this ticket is a good first look at how we handle drift. The Proselint-Q documentation linter in staging has diverged from the committed baseline: rule severities were hand-edited during the Marrowfield docs sprint and never merged back. As a result, CI passes locally but fails on shared runners. Please compare the live settings against the repo, open a PR to reconcile, and note any intentional changes. The current live configuration is captured below.

settings of yageg-yahap:
[gorael]
team = olieth
access_code = ac_941d74
owner = brieth.aldiel
host = gorael.tolvaqio.internal
port = 6379
peer = briwyn.urlaqtech.internal
salt = 116e6622
pin = 1957